package com.hazelcast.concurrent.lock;
import com.hazelcast.nio.ObjectDataInput;
import com.hazelcast.nio.ObjectDataOutput;
import com.hazelcast.nio.serialization.SerializableByConvention;
import com.hazelcast.spi.ObjectNamespace;
import com.hazelcast.spi.impl.operationparker.impl.OperationParkerImpl;
import java.io.IOException;
import static com.hazelcast.nio.serialization.SerializableByConvention.Reason.PUBLIC_API;
/**
* A specialization of {@link ObjectNamespace} intended to be used by ILock proxies.
*
* It intentionally <b>does not</b> use {@link #name} field in <code>equals()</code>
* and <code>hashcode()</code> methods. This is a hack to share a single instance of
* {@link LockStore} for all ILocks proxies (per partition).
*
* Discussion:
*
* If we included the name in equals()/hashcode() methods then each ILock would create
* its own {@link LockStoreImpl}. Each <code>LockStoreImpl</code> contains additional
* mapping key -> LockResource. However ILock proxies always use a single key only
* thus creating a <code>LockStoreImpl</code> for each ILock would introduce an unnecessary
* indirection and memory waster. Also each LockStoreImpl is maintaining its own
* scheduler for lock eviction purposes, etc.
*
* I originally wanted to remove the <code>name</code> field and use a constant,
* but it has side-effects - for example when a ILock proxy is destroyed then you
* want to destroy all pending {@link com.hazelcast.spi.BlockingOperation}
*
* @see LockStoreContainer#getOrCreateLockStore(ObjectNamespace)
* @see OperationParkerImpl#cancelParkedOperations(String, Object, Throwable)
*
*/
@SerializableByConvention(PUBLIC_API)
public final class InternalLockNamespace implements ObjectNamespace {
private String name;
public InternalLockNamespace() {
}
public InternalLockNamespace(String name) {
this.name = name;
}
@Override
public String getServiceName() {
return LockService.SERVICE_NAME;
}
@Override
public String getObjectName() {
return name;
}
@Override
public void writeData(ObjectDataOutput out) throws IOException {
out.writeUTF(name);
}
@Override
public void readData(ObjectDataInput in) throws IOException {
name = in.readUTF();
}
@Override
public boolean equals(Object o) {
if (this == o) {
return true;
}
if (o == null || getClass() != o.getClass()) {
return false;
}
//warning: this intentionally does not use name field see class-level JavaDoc above
return true;
}
@Override
public int hashCode() {
//warning: this intentionally does not use name field see class-level JavaDoc above
return getServiceName().hashCode();
}
@Override
public String toString() {
return "InternalLockNamespace{service='" + LockService.SERVICE_NAME + '\'' + ", objectName=" + name + '}';
}
}
